Nanjing University proposes an L0–L7 ladder for evaluating embodied world models
jiqizhixin · x · 2026-07-21
Researchers at Nanjing University propose a new way to evaluate world models for embodied AI: not by how realistic the videos look, but by whether they help with planning, policy evaluation, and long-horizon decision-making in real environments.
They introduce an L0–L7 evaluation ladder that is meant to capture decision-making utility more directly than existing video-centric benchmarks, arguing that current metrics can miss models that look good but fail where it matters.
- Core claim: visual realism is not enough
- Focus: planning, policy evaluation, long-horizon reasoning
- Method: L0–L7 ladder for decision-making-centric evaluation
- Takeaway: benchmark choice can reveal mismatches hidden by video metrics
